WebIf one of you is in the army, you can petition for divorce in the U.S. state where: You pay taxes Your spouse resides You last lived as a married couple for at least six months You’re stationed, even if you’re not a resident of that state Having more options allows you to choose the jurisdiction that’s best for your case. WebJan 6, 2024 · The cost of a divorce can vary depending on location, the complexity of the financial assets, and how amicable the divorce is. Even the simplest of splits will incur at least a filing fee of a few hundred dollars, while more contentious divorces that involve various assets can reach as much as $20,000 or much more.
